Historical Sites Visited
Exploring the historical sites on the Pompeii Sorrento and Positano Tour reveals a captivating journey through ancient ruins and cultural landmarks. One of the highlights is the Pompeii excavation, where visitors can witness the remarkably preserved ancient Roman city frozen in time by the eruption of Mount Vesuvius. Walking through the streets of Pompeii offers a unique glimpse into daily life during that era.
Moving along the tour, the scenic drive along the Sorrento coastline provides breathtaking views of the Mediterranean Sea, dotted with colorful villages clinging to the cliffs. The combination of historical immersion at Pompeii and the natural beauty of the Sorrento coastline makes this tour a truly unforgettable experience for history enthusiasts and nature lovers alike.
Local Cuisine Tasting
Indulging in the flavors of the region, one can savor the essence of local cuisine on the Pompeii Sorrento and Positano Tour. This culinary experience offers a unique opportunity for food sampling and culture. Here are some highlights of what to expect:
Limoncello Tasting: Enjoy the zesty flavors of this traditional Italian liqueur made from Sorrento lemons.
Pizza Margherita: Delight in a classic Neapolitan pizza topped with fresh tomatoes, mozzarella, and basil.
Seafood Delicacies: Sample the catch of the day prepared in traditional coastal styles.
Linguine al Limone: Taste the creamy and citrusy pasta dish that’s a specialty of the region.
Gelato: Treat yourself to some authentic Italian gelato in various flavors.
